Good pants usually have an inch or two in the waist to give, but most coat enlargements are impossible. … optimal health edmond oklahomaWebDec 11, 2024 · Fill a medium-sized pot with water and place it on the stove. Turn the heat to high until the water boils. Turn off the stove. Hold the cap by the brim about 6 inches away from the pot's steam. Allow the steam to penetrate the inside of the cap and the band for about 30 seconds. Take the cap away for another 30 seconds. portland or naturopathic doctorsWebJul 26, 2012 · Jul 14, 2012. #1.
